Transaction 089af60239b4ebedfbab7cb00db368d93d007f0d457150c0efff0d6ac8809b66
1 Input
1 Output
-
089af60239b4ebedfbab7cb00db368d93d007f0d457150c0efff0d6ac8809b66:0
- value
- 100982869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 720a9b6ad5889fe1f451c2894c22b1ccd242d69c OP_EQUAL
- address
- 3C61fQXyApjgiLYJPpmPaCynpByeVgaem5